Leh, May 05: Adding to the growing spiritual significance of the ongoing relic exposition, His Eminence Ngawang Jamyang Chamba Stanzin today visited Jivetsal Choglamsar and paid homage to the sacred relics of Gautama Buddha.
Accompanied by Kelkhang Rinpoche, His Eminence offered prayers in a serene and spiritually charged atmosphere. An official from the National Museum was also present and presented a memento to the Rinpoche on the occasion.
Kelkhang Rinpoche also paid obeisance to the holy relics, reflecting the deep reverence associated with the sacred exposition. Devotees and officials present witnessed the solemn visit, further enhancing the sanctity of the occasion.
The sacred relics will remain at Jivetsal until May 11, after which they will be taken to Zanskar as part of the continuing exposition, carrying forward the message of peace, devotion, and spiritual unity across the region.
